10 Essential Web Developer Tools for 2024: A Comprehensive Guide

10 Essential Web Developer Tools for 2024
The landscape of web development is constantly evolving. As developers, we are always on the lookout for tools that can streamline our workflows, catch errors before they become bugs, and generally make our lives easier.
With the sheer number of utilities available online today, finding the right ones can be overwhelming. Some tools are bloated with ads, while others are slow and force you to process data on their servers, raising privacy concerns.
In this comprehensive guide, we will explore 10 essential, privacy-first web developer tools that you should be using in 2024. These tools cover everything from text encoding and code formatting to network analysis and color generation.
1. The JSON Validator and Formatter
Handling JSON data is a daily task to nearly every web developer, whether you are building frontend applications, developing APIs, or managing configurations. However, a single missing comma or unmatched brace can break an entire system.
A high-quality JSON Validator is indispensable. The best validators do more than merely tell you if your JSON is valid; they tell you exactly where the error is located. Look for a tool that offers:
- Instant client-side validation (no data sent to a server).
- Tree-view and plain-text visualization options.
- The ability to minify or format (beautify) the JSON string.
2. Base64 Encoder and Decoder
Base64 encoding is widely used on the web. It's used for embedding small images directly into CSS or HTML (to save HTTP requests), encoding credentials in Basic Authentication headers, and safely transmitting binary data within JSON payloads.
Having a fast, secure Base64 Encoder at your fingertips saves precious minutes. Security is critical here; if you are encoding sensitive API keys or credentials, you must ensure the conversion happens locally in your browser so that the keys are never logged on a remote server.
3. Regular Expression (RegEx) Tester
Regular expressions are incredibly powerful for parsing, searching, and validating strings. They are also notoriously difficult to write and debug. Even seasoned developers often rely on trial and error when crafting complex patterns.
A visual RegEx Tester allows you to test your expressions against sample text in real-time. It highlights matching groups, explains the rules you've written, and helps you identify edge cases that your expression might miss. Whether you are validating email addresses, parsing logs, or extracting data from HTML, a RegEx tester is a must-have.
4. URL Encoder and Decoder
If you've ever dealt with query parameters, you know the pain of URL encoding. Certain characters (like spaces, ampersands, and question marks) have special meanings in URLs. If you need to send these characters as data, they must be "escaped" or encoded (e.g., a space becomes %20).
A simple URL Encoder allows you to quickly paste a string and get the safe URL-encoded version, or take an encoded URL and decode it back into readable text. This is particularly useful when debugging API requests or analyzing messy analytics links.
5. Hash Generator (MD5, SHA-256)
Cryptographic hashes are fundamental to software security. They are used to verify file integrity, store passwords securely (often alongside a "salt"), and generate unique device identifiers.
A versatile Hash Generator allows you to instantly compute the MD5, SHA-1, SHA-256, or SHA-512 hashes of any text string. Again, privacy is paramount. When generating hashes for sensitive data, ensure you are using a tool that runs purely client-side so your plaintext data is never exposed.
6. CSS Color Palette Generator
Creative developers frequently find themselves needing to pick colors that work well together. Whether you are designing a new landing page from scratch, creating a dashboard theme, or just trying to find a complementary color for a button, color theory can be challenging.
A dynamic Color Palette Generator simplifies this process. It can help you generate monochromatic, analogous, or complementary color schemes instantly. The best tools will provide the colors in HEX, RGB, and HSL formats so you can seamlessly copy them directly into your CSS files.
7. Dummy Text (Lorem Ipsum) Generator
When building UI layouts, wireframes, or frontend prototypes, you rarely have the final copy available. Waiting for content can block development.
A customizable Lorem Ipsum Generator is the perfect solution. Instead of typing "test test test" repeatedly, you can generate realistic-looking paragraphs, sentences, or precise word counts of dummy text. This ensures your layouts are tested with realistic block sizes and typography scales.
8. File Hash Generator
While the text hash generator is great for strings, what about verifying the integrity of a downloaded file or an ISO image? If you download a Linux distribution or a software installer, the provider often lists a SHA-256 checksum.
A File Hash Generator allows you to select a file from your computer and calculate its hash locally. By comparing this hash to the one provided by the author, you can guarantee that the file was not corrupted during the download and has not been maliciously altered.
9. Network Ping and IP Tools
Web developers often have to wear the hat of a systems administrator. When an API goes down, or a website fails to load, the first step is to diagnose the network.
Having quick access to tools like a Network Ping Tool or an IP Address Analyzer helps you verify if a server is reachable, check its response time, and view the geolocation and ISP details of a specific IP address.
10. UUID / GUID Generator
Universally Unique Identifiers (UUIDs) are 128-bit numbers used to identify information in computer systems safely. They are practically guaranteed to be unique across space and time, making them ideal for database primary keys, session IDs, and transaction references.
A UUID Generator allows you to instantly generate random V4 UUIDs in bulk. This is incredibly helpful when seeding databases with mock data, creating configuration files, or writing unit tests that require unique identifiers.
Conclusion
Having the right tools at your disposal can drastically reduce friction in your daily development workflow. By bookmarking a unified platform like Universal Web Toolkit, you gain instant access to all these utilities—and over 40 more—in one central, privacy-focused location.
What's your favorite developer tool? Make sure to explore our full suite of free utilities and streamline your coding process today!